Stanford Twenty 20 Match

Kevin Pietersen and the England Cricket Team are set to give some of the prize money from the Stanford Super Series Twenty20 Match to charity, if they win.

The match was in doubt of going ahead because of legal problems, but today reports suggest those problems have been resolved.

England will play the $20 million clash against a West Indies team, the Stanford Superstars.

England’s captain Pieterson said, ‘If we win then we have to realise there are a lot of people a lot worse off than us and it doesn’t do any harm to put a smile on people’s faces.’

The Stanford Super Series Twenty20 Match, Stanford Superstars vs. England, is on November 1.
